All these parafunctional routines create some type of forces throughout the stomatoganthic program. Having said that, their harmful effects article depend on the magnitude, path, period, along with the frequency in the power applied to the method. Among these usually noticed oral parafunctional behavior, bruxism and clenching tend to be more crucial because they create major occlusal forces inside the stomatoganthic process, and these routines can manifest subconsciously as well as people are often unaware with regards to their Lively parafunction.

Determine 20-two Comparison of overjet, the horizontal overlap amongst the two arches, and overbite, the vertical overlap in between the two arches. Overjet is calculated in millimeters with the idea of the periodontal probe, as soon as a patient is in centric occlusion. The probe is positioned in a correct angle into the labial surface area of the mandibular incisor at The bottom in the incisal fringe of a maxillary incisor.

Anterior steerage might be even more categorised. 'Canine guidance' refers to some dynamic occlusion that occurs about the canines for the duration of a lateral excursion on the mandible.
